Theodore Tso wrote: > > At the moment, if you want ^C to interrupt the e2fsck and you want the > boot to continue, you actually have to set the following in > /etc/e2fsck.conf: > > [options] > allow_cancellation = 1 > > See the e2fsck.conf(8) man page for more details. > > Regards, > > - Ted Is there a way to set hard and soft limit? IE, after 30 mounts, checking is strongly suggested and automatically run, but able to be canceled but after 35 it is mandatory?
